The actual underlying ServSafe Manager course (which you may choose or be required to complete before testing) covers essential food safety topics:

  • Understanding and Preventing Foodborne Illness (Pathogens, Allergens, Contaminants)
  • Maintaining Personal Hygiene
  • Proper Handling and Storage of Food
  • Preventing Cross-Contamination
  • Implementing Time and Temperature Controls
  • Cleaning and Sanitizing Procedures
  • Safe Food Facility and Equipment Management
  • Developing a Comprehensive Food Safety Management System (HACCP)
  • Training Staff in Food Safety

What to Expect in the Final Exam

The final official ServSafe Manager Exam is a standardized test administered by authorized proctors across Alabama and nationwide. Here are typical details of what to expect:

  • Format: The exam usually consists of around 90 multiple-choice questions. A subset of these questions might be pilot questions, which are not scored, but all questions should be attempted with your best effort.
  • Proctoring: It must be taken under the supervision of a certified ServSafe Proctor or at an approved testing facility.
  • Time Limit: Students generally have around two hours to complete the test.
  • Passing Score: The required passing score, often around 75%, is a high standard demonstrating strong knowledge of food safety. Re-check the current required passing threshold on the official ServSafe website.
  • Specific Rules: Standard testing protocols apply, including rules against cheating and the potential requirement for valid photo identification.

 

 How to Study and Exam Centers

Effective preparation is key to success on the ServSafe Manager Exam. Follow these actionable study strategies and consider your testing options:

Study Actionably:

Utilize Official Resources: Start with the ServSafe Manager Book and take advantage of any official courses.

Take Practice Exams Repeatedly: Use this practice exam and others multiple times. Note areas where you consistently struggle.

Review Rationales: Don't just check if you are right or wrong; read the provided explanations for every answer.

Create Flashcards: Use flashcards for key facts, critical temperatures, times, and specific procedures.

Practice Time Management: Simulate the timed environment on practice tests to improve speed and focus.

Exam Centers: The final official exam requires an authorized administrator. You can find locations and proctors in Alabama using these methods:

  • Authorized Training Schools: Many community colleges, vocational schools, and restaurant associations in Alabama offer ServSafe Manager courses and proctored exams.
  • Independent Proctors: Search for independent ServSafe-certified proctors who can administer the test for you.
  • In-Person Class Completion: The most common approach is taking a ServSafe Manager class and completing the exam directly afterward.
